Output 3a1095a0c3594db0a20a7f8c70032ffa9537a1c55e3e86cc0fd3bb516c201e03:1

value
509332213
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b124a57ba87f6d61c8d25ec93dae9afda88e6376 OP_EQUALVERIFY OP_CHECKSIG
address
1H9eWC84XVYhAgA6uBkmk2nZH7xnbi2gcL
transaction
3a1095a0c3594db0a20a7f8c70032ffa9537a1c55e3e86cc0fd3bb516c201e03
spent
true